Nothing's more frustrating than posting an Instagram Story only to find it looks blurry and pixelated. This comprehensive guide explains why Instagram Stories become blurry and provides proven solutions to fix the problem immediately.
Quick Fix:
Most blurry Instagram Stories are caused by poor internet connection, incorrect image dimensions, or outdated app versions. Follow our step-by-step solutions below to fix the issue.

Conclusion
Blurry Instagram Stories are usually caused by internet connection issues, incorrect image dimensions, or app problems rather than your phone's camera quality. By following the solutions in this guide - checking your connection, updating the app, optimizing photos, and adjusting settings - you can consistently post crystal-clear Stories.
Remember that prevention is better than fixing problems after they occur. Always check your internet connection, keep your app updated, and take photos in good lighting with proper dimensions for the best Instagram Story quality every time.
